城际铁路动车组交路计划优化模型
Optimization model of rolling stock circulation of intercity railway

Optimization of rolling stock circulation is one of the key problems of intercity railway operation management. According to the characteristic of high train density of intercity railway, the paper built an optimization model of rolling stock circulation of intercity railway based on time-line network modeling and devised an iterative solution method embedded solving engine of CPLEX, and made verification and comparative analysis with several examples of intercity railway. The results indicate that time-line network can reduce the model size efficiently compared to connection network, and therefore model based on time-line network has quite good applicability with more rapid and efficient solving performance than model based on connection network when solving rolling stock circulation of railway with high train density such as intercity railway.关键词
